Mickelson is leading purveyor of paradox
Phil Mickelson is a paradox. Here is a man who makes more birdies than possibly anyone else in the world, and yet makes just enough bogeys to prevent him realising his greatest ambitions. Here is a man who is hailed as one of the game's great putters, who misses more important three-footers than anyone in living memory.
